Subject: Re: [PATCH v5 2/2] dt-bindings: timer: Add compatible for am6 for TI timer-dm
Date: Mon, 25 Apr 2022 16:55:12 -0500	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<YmcYwD6f/I59ucTR@robh.at.kernel.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220414085807.7389-3-tony@atomide.com>

On Thu, 14 Apr 2022 11:58:07 +0300, Tony Lindgren wrote:
> Let's add compatible for ti,am654-timer for TI am64, am65 and j72 SoCs.
> As the timer hardware is the same between am64, am65 and j72 we use the
> compatible name for the earliest SoC with this timer.
> 
> The timer interrupts are not routable for the operating system for some
> timers on am6. Let's make sure the interrupts are configured for the
> timers on all other SoCs.
